Understanding Sump Pumps and Their Importance

A sump pump is an indispensable device in basements and crawl spaces, designed to prevent flooding. It consists of a engine that draws water from a pit called a sump basin. When the water level reaches a certain point, the sensor activates the pump, forcing the water out through a discharge pipe.

They are vital in protecting your home from the destructive effects of flooding, which can cause damage to walls, floors, and items. Without a sump pump, even minor rainfall could cause significant water accumulation in your basement, creating a breeding ground for mold and mildew.

Always examine your sump pump to ensure it's functioning properly. This includes testing the switch, checking the discharge pipe for clogs, and cleaning the basin. By taking these simple steps, you can help prevent costly repairs and keep your home dry and safe.

Routine Plumbing Issues and How to Fix Them

Owning a home often comes with the inevitable task of dealing with plumbing issues. While some problems may require a professional plumber, many common matters can be handled by a homeowner with a little know-how and the right tools. One frequently faced issue is a leaky faucet. This can often be fixed by simply tightening the handle. If that doesn't work, you may need to replace a worn-out washer or O-ring. Another common problem is a clogged drain. You can try using a plunger to unclog the blockage, or you can pour boiling water down the drain to dissolve any grease or soap buildup. For more stubborn clogs, a drain snake may be necessary.

  • Always check your plumbing fixtures for leaks and address them promptly to prevent further damage.
  • Service your water heater annually to ensure it's operating efficiently and safely.
  • Be cautious when using harsh chemicals in your drains, as they can damage pipes over time.
